Q: How can I avoid online job scams?
A: To avoid online job scams, always research the company thoroughly. Check for a legitimate website, professional email addresses (not generic ones), and consistent online presence. Never pay money for job applications or training materials. Be suspicious of offers that seem too good to be true, or requests for sensitive personal information early in the process. Use trusted job platforms and read reviews.

How Do You Spot a Legitimate Free Online Job?
It's crucial to be vigilant. Legitimate free online jobs will never ask you for money to apply or start. If an opportunity demands an upfront payment for 'certification,' 'software,' or 'registration,' it's likely a scam. Always research the company thoroughly before providing any personal information. Check for reviews, official websites, and professional social media presence. In 2026, many reputable companies actively recruit directly on their own career pages or through well-known job boards that vet postings.

Top Free Online Job Categories for Americans
The variety of free online jobs available today is truly impressive. Here are some of the most sought-after categories where you can typically find opportunities without upfront costs:
- Data Entry: Simple, repetitive tasks like inputting information into spreadsheets or databases. Many companies still need human eyes for accuracy.
- Transcription: Converting audio or video files into written text. This requires good listening skills and fast typing. Legal and medical transcription often pay more.
- Virtual Assistant (VA): Providing administrative, technical, or creative assistance to clients remotely. Tasks can range from managing emails to scheduling appointments.
- Online Tutoring/Teaching: If you have expertise in a subject, platforms connect you with students needing help. English as a Second Language (ESL) tutoring is particularly popular.
- Content Creation/Writing: Writing articles, blog posts, social media content, or ad copy for businesses. A knack for words is key here.
- Micro-tasks: Completing small, discrete tasks like image tagging, survey taking, or content moderation. Platforms like Amazon Mechanical Turk offer these.
- Customer Service: Many companies hire remote customer service representatives to handle inquiries via phone, chat, or email.
Where Can Americans Find These Opportunities?
You don't need a secret handshake to find these gigs. There are many reputable platforms that list free online jobs. Start with the big names:
- Indeed and LinkedIn: Use filters like 'remote' or 'work from home' and keywords like 'no experience' or 'entry-level.'
- FlexJobs: While some premium features require a subscription, many free job listings are available, and they rigorously vet all postings.
- Upwork and Fiverr: These are freelance marketplaces where you create a profile and offer your services. You might bid on projects or list your services for clients to find you. There are no upfront fees to create a profile.
- Specific Niche Sites: For transcription, look at TranscribeMe or Rev. For micro-tasks, consider Appen or Clickworker.
